In New York State, sexual assault is defined as any form of sexual contact without legal consent. This includes various acts, from unwanted touching to forcible penetration. If you’ve experienced such an offense, you have the right to press charges and seek criminal prosecution. A qualified sexual abuse lawyer in New York City will help you understand the legal process, collect evidence, and build a strong case against your assailant. It’s important to act promptly, as there are strict time limits for filing complaints and initiating legal procedures.
The city offers numerous resources specifically tailored to support survivors of sexual assault. These include specialized police units, crisis hotlines, and medical facilities equipped to handle such cases sensitively and effectively. For instance, the New York City Police Department’s Special Victims Unit (SVU) is renowned for its handling of sexual assault cases, providing a dedicated team of officers trained in these sensitive investigations. Additionally, organizations like the New York City Alliance against Sexual Assault offer legal advocacy and support services, ensuring survivors have access to knowledgeable sexual abuse attorneys and counseling resources.

In New York City, numerous organizations offer comprehensive services tailored to women’s unique needs after a sexual assault. These include crisis hotlines, counseling centers, and advocacy groups that provide immediate assistance and long-term support. For instance, organizations like the New York City Alliance Against Sexual Assault (NYCAASA) offer legal advocacy, support groups, and education programs, empowering survivors to understand their rights and take action.
